New rails, new fun @ the Derome Cable!

Wow Plaza chez les Derome's is gearing up for a new season with some new rails. They modified the previous flat bar into a sick looking flat up down. The A-frame has been changed as well with the addition of a flat down/up flat section. If this weather keeps up, we will be able to hit these new beauties in no time!! Wakeboarding and the 2020 Olympics.


Open publication - Free publishing - More wake

Stumbled upon this publication from the International Wakeboard Waterski Federation (IWWF) in order to persuade the International Olympic Committee (IOC) to include cable wakeboarding in the 2020 Summer Olympics.

For those who don't know, wakeboarding has been shortlisted along with eight other sports to be added in 2020. Not sure what the chances are, but judging from this brochure I think it has a legitimate shot of making it. Take a minute, judge for yourself....

The 1st Annual Standard Classic Shinny Tournament


1st Annual "STANDARD CLASSIC INVITATIONAL" shinny tournament from House Edge Productions on Vimeo.
This past Sunday, my boy Sammy 'Franchise' Francis organized the first annual Standard Classic Invitational hockey tournament to raise money for our favourite outdoor rink located just behind Elgin Street. 

The event was sponsored by the Standard Luxury Tavern, local microbrewery Kichesippi Beer Co., and Top of the World. It was a great day of hockey that saw eight teams (Oz/Town, Manx, Woody's, Hooley's, Kichesippi, Top of the World, Fresco, Standard) compete for the ultimate bragging rights and the coveted Kichesippi keg trophy. 

Players and spectators alike braved freezing temperatures to join in on the great day of hockey, beer, and community spirit.
